Maximize Your Wealth: The Ultimate Guide to Social Media Networks for High Net Worth Individuals

High net worth individuals seek social media networks that deliver privacy, exclusivity, and meaningful engagement rather than mass-market exposure. These platforms enable curated networking, reputation management, and access to influential circles while aligning with stringent security and service expectations.

Below is a structured overview of how HNWI adapt social media across objectives, audiences, security, and monetization dimensions.

LinkedIn for Executive Presence and Capital Access

Positioning and Networking

LinkedIn serves as a professional repository where HNWI showcase board memberships, executive history, and thought leadership. A refined headline, strategic endorsements, and selective publishing help attract investors, board seats, and advisory roles.

Content Strategy for Authority Building

Long-form articles, curated industry insights, and succinct commentary on regulation and market trends position wealthy professionals as credible voices. Targeted outreach to recruiters, family office principals, and corporate strategists amplifies reach within high-value networks.

Instagram for Luxury Lifestyle Branding

Visual Narrative and Aesthetic Curation

High-production visuals, consistent palettes, and minimal captions communicate taste and exclusivity. HNWI often coordinate feeds with private designers, photographers, and stylists to maintain a coherent luxury identity.

Engagement Tactics and Community Management

Close-friend stories, VIP takeovers, and limited-drop announcements foster deeper connection. Moderated comment settings and private-list management protect privacy while nurturing a follower base that interacts beyond surface-level engagement.

Twitter / X for Real-Time Influence and Market Intelligence

Concise Commentary and Market Signals

Short threads on macro trends, central bank policy, and emerging tech allow HNWI to signal expertise without lengthy publishing cycles. A verified badge and disciplined tone enhance perceived authority and trust.

Strategic Following and List Management

Curated lists of policymakers, analysts, and founders create a focused feed for timely insights. Direct, thoughtful replies to key accounts can open doors to collaborations, speaking engagements, and co-investment opportunities.

Private Communities and Exclusive Platforms

Gatekeeping and Membership Models

Private Discord servers, Circle.so hubs, and invitation-only apps provide controlled environments for deal flow, collectible trading, and philanthropic coordination. Membership tiers and application workflows reinforce exclusivity and safety.

Security and Moderation Practices

White-listing, two-factor authentication, and role-based permissions minimize exposure. Dedicated moderators, clear community guidelines, and encrypted integrations support confidentiality and accountability.

Strategic Roadmap for HNWI Social Media

  • Define clear objectives: brand authority, capital access, or community building.
  • Select platforms aligned with audience and risk preferences.
  • Implement enterprise-grade security: 2FA, whitelisting, and periodic audits.
  • Curate content pillars and production workflows with trusted partners.
  • Track KPIs such as engagement quality, inbound opportunities, and referral value.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I evaluate which social media network aligns best with my wealth management goals?

Map objectives to platforms: capital access favors LinkedIn and AngelList, lifestyle influence suits Instagram, and real-time intelligence works on X. Define your risk tolerance for public exposure and choose tools with robust privacy controls.

What privacy safeguards should high net worth users prioritize on social media?

Enable two-factor authentication, use close-friend lists for stories, limit location tagging, employ separate profiles for professional and personal contexts, and regularly audit third-party app permissions.

Can social media generate tangible business outcomes for HNWI beyond reputation?

Yes, targeted content can surface deal flow, board opportunities, and co-investor matches. Combining consistent thought leadership with offline due diligence turns digital presence into measurable commercial introductions.

How frequently should high net worth individuals post to maintain influence without oversharing?

Aim for quality over quantity: one in-depth LinkedIn article weekly, two to three curated Instagram touches per week, and daily concise insights on X. Adjust cadence based on engagement metrics and personal bandwidth.
